Storyboards help you organize and refine content ideas clearly and visually. Use buckets like Idea, Draft, Review, and Approved to track progress, and manage each card with tags, tasks, deadlines, owners, and all the necessary context. You can also attach links, media, and other assets to each card.


How to set up Storyboards

To create a new Storyboard, open the three‑dot menu next to the Storyboard selector and choose Create Storyboard. Enter a name, upload a background image, and define the color scheme, then click Create Storyboard.

Next, set up your buckets based on your workflows.

If you like, mark the Storyboard as a favorite from the three‑dot menu for quicker access.

How to use

New idea? Create a Storycard in the appropriate bucket, or click the Create Story button in the top-right corner. Add the story's basic details, attach relevant links, and, if helpful, use the briefing area for a short explanation.

Has the story progressed? Assign tasks to the right people directly from the Storycard to keep everything connected. Once tasks are assigned, you can display a progress bar. When all tasks are complete and the story is ready to go live, create the content piece and close the Storycard.

View settings

You can use the settings to tailor the Storyboards view to your workflow. Choose how tags are displayed, whether to show a task progress bar based on the story card’s assigned tasks, and whether archived stories should be visible inline. If you turn off inline visibility, archived stories will appear in the Archived folder.
